Output e505b67ee1ea7bd32c232baaedfab3f48dc2e41e050833ed3661c5ad86ade979:45

value
22293508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1e0731fbcc8ba2cfbdea03fa454711855b6a5b OP_EQUAL
address
MR3qEtD5sMgUQP31MeVH6RRqpPLg8pEk2y
transaction
e505b67ee1ea7bd32c232baaedfab3f48dc2e41e050833ed3661c5ad86ade979
spent
true